This tax credit is much easier to obtain if you might have a child, but that does not mean which will automatically get which it. In order to obtain the EIC on the basis of your child, your child must be under eighteen years of age, under age twenty-four and currently taking post-secondary classes, or over eighteen many years of age with disabilities that are cared for by a parent or gaurdian.

For example, most of us will fall in the 25% federal tax rate, and let's guess that our state income tax rate is 3%. Supplies us a marginal tax rate of 28%. We subtract.28 from 1.00 leaving.72 or 72%. This world of retail a non-taxable interest rate of .6% would be the same return to be a taxable rate of 5%. That was derived by multiplying 5% by 72%. So any non-taxable return greater than 3.6% would be preferable with taxable rate of 5%.
